Venerate® XC Bioinsecticide is effective against a wide variety of chewing and sucking insects and mites.Novel modes of action will complement and improve integrated pest management (IPM) and insect resistance management (IRM) programs.MRL Exempt4-Hour REI0-Day PHI

Functions: Insecticide

Insecticide Target Species: Aphids, Leafhoppers, Stinkbugs, Thrips

Application Technique: Aerial Application, Chemigation, Sprayers

Art of use
  • Direct contact or ingestion by targeted insect or mites is necessary
  • Contact and molting interference may take up to 7 days to observe
  • Alternate with another chemistry on a 7-day interval
  • 50-100 GPA is recommended for most horticultural applications
  • Avoid spray volumes that result in spray runoff
  • No maximum number of applications/season
